Experiencing the Beauty of Sakhalin

A large elongated island, Sakhalin is found in the North Pacific and it is the largest island in Russia. Its name simply means “God of mouth of water land” and this name was restored to the island by the Japanese in their possession of its southern part.

The island was said to be inhabited during the Neolithic Stone SakhalinAge. It was in the year 1679 when a Japanese settlement in the southern end of the island was established as a colonization attempt. Russia and Japan had signed the Treaty of Shimoda which declared that both could inhabit the island where the Russians can occupy the north and the Japanese in the south in 1855.

The island is covered with dense forests which are mostly coniferous. Among the species which can be seen in Sakhalin are bears, foxes, otters and stables. There are also lots of fishes in the rivers which include the endangered Western Pacific gray whale.
